Deck Remodeling in Seattle, WA
Deck remodeling services involve updating, repairing, or enhancing existing decks to improve their appearance, functionality, and safety. Projects may include replacing worn or damaged boards, upgrading railings, adding new features such as built-in seating or lighting, and customizing the layout to better suit outdoor living needs. Homeowners often seek deck remodeling to refresh the look of their outdoor space, increase property value, or adapt their decks for new uses, such as entertaining or relaxing with family and friends. Before requesting a remodel, property owners should consider the current condition of their deck, desired design changes, and any structural or safety concerns that need addressing.
Understanding the scope of a deck remodeling project is essential for homeowners planning to update their outdoor space. It’s helpful to know what materials and styles are available, as well as any local building codes or regulations that may influence the design. Property owners should also evaluate their budget and priorities, such as whether the focus is on aesthetic improvements, increased durability, or additional features.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the remodeling process aligns with their expectations and results in a functional, attractive outdoor area.

Common Deck Remodeling Jobs
Deck Replacement - upgrading an aging or damaged deck to improve safety and appearance.
Surface Refinishing - restoring worn or faded deck surfaces for a fresh, polished look.
Adding Built-In Features - incorporating benches, planters, or lighting for enhanced functionality.
Expanding Deck Space - enlarging existing decks to create more outdoor entertainment areas.
Railing and Barrier Updates - replacing or installing new railings for safety and style.
Custom Deck Designs - creating tailored layouts and features to suit specific outdoor living needs.
Deck Remodeling Questions
What are common reasons to remodel a deck? Remodeling can enhance safety, improve appearance, increase functionality, or update materials to match current styles.
Can deck remodeling include adding features? Yes, features like built-in seating, lighting, or additional stairs can be incorporated during remodeling projects.
Is it possible to update a worn-out deck without replacing it entirely? Yes, repairs, resurfacing, or refinishing can restore a deck's appearance and extend its lifespan.
What should homeowners consider before remodeling a deck? It's important to evaluate the existing structure, desired features, and any necessary permits or codes in the area.
